This February, skip the typical Friday night routine and step into the world of Argentine Tango. Often called "a love story told in three minutes," Tango is more than just a dance—it’s a conversation without words, built on trust, presence, and the power of the embrace (el abrazo).
Whether you're looking for a unique date night activity or a way to meet new people and move your body, this 4-week workshop series is designed to take you from the very first step to a confident, elegant walk on the dance floor.

FAQs
- Do I need a partner? No! We rotate partners throughout the class to help everyone learn the art of connection. However, if you come with a partner and prefer to stay together, that’s perfectly fine too.
- What should I wear? Comfortable clothing that allows you to move. For shoes, wear something with a smooth sole (leather or suede) that allows you to pivot easily. Avoid heavy rubber-soled sneakers.
- Is this for beginners? Yes! This series is designed for absolute beginners and those looking to refine their foundational technique.
